If you're acquiring an auto with cash, check your checking account and calculate the overall cost you can moderately afford to pay. If you're purchasing an auto with an auto loan, compare your present monthly costs to your revenue and find out the monthly auto repayment you can pay for. Make use of the Edmunds automobile lending calculator to estimate the car settlement and funding quantity required based upon the rate of a car.


Keep in mind, you'll additionally spend for the car registration, tax obligations and costs, so anticipate to pay even more. Don't fail to remember to consider the size of the down settlement you can manage. You'll pay that upfront. When computing your spending plan, include other automobile owner expenditures like fuel, upkeep, automobile insurance coverage and repair work.


Rolling over your old lending into your new one means remaining to pay for (and pay rate of interest on) an auto you're no longer using. You might have the ability to get even more money for your old automobile by selling it independently over trading it in. Then, make use of the cash toward your deposit.

Mentioning stating the right things, don't tell the dealership what monthly payment you're searching for. If you want the ideal deal, start negotiations by asking the dealership what the out-the-door price is.


Mazda3 Dealer Near MeMazda Dealer Near Me
FYI: The sticker label rate isn't the total price of the auto it's just the manufacturer's suggested retail price (MSRP). Bear in mind those tax obligations and costs we claimed you'll need to pay when acquiring a cars and truck? Those are consisted of (in addition to the MSRP) in what's called the out-the-door cost. So why discuss based on the out-the-door price? Dealers can prolong finance settlement terms to strike your target regular monthly settlement while not reducing the out-the-door cost, and you'll end up paying more passion in the long run.


Both you and the supplier are qualified to a fair deal however you'll likely finish up paying a little bit greater than you want and the supplier will likely get a little less than they desire - mazda cx-50 dealer near me. Always begin settlements by asking what the out-the-door cost is and go from there.
